Contrast Health Insurance Plans Side-by-Side

Navigating the world of health insurance can be daunting. With a myriad of plans available, each offering diverse coverages, it's crucial to meticulously compare your options. Developing a side-by-side comparison chart allows you to effectively compare key aspects such as premiums, deductibles, copayments, and coverage for specific medical needs.

  • List your top choices of health insurance plans.
  • Organize a table with columns for each plan and rows for key variables such as monthly premiums, deductibles, copayments, and out-of-pocket maximums.
  • Note the detailed coverage offered by each plan, paying attention to medication coverage, preventive care, hospitalization, and specialist consultations.
  • Read the policy details carefully to understand any exclusions on coverage.

By methodically comparing plans side-by-side, you can make an educated decision that best suits your well-being needs and budget.

Selecting a Health Plan: Key Factors to Consider

When embarking on the quest of selecting a health plan, it's crucial to carefully evaluate several key factors. Your personal needs and situation should influence your choice. A thorough understanding of available options will empower you in determining the most suitable plan for your health.

  • Protection: Assess the scope of coverage provided, including hospitalization, doctor visits, medications, and emergency services.
  • Provider Access: Determine the plan's physician network of doctors and medical facilities that accept your chosen plan.
  • Premiums: Meticulously examine the monthly contributions, copays, and sharing costs.
  • Plan Type: Explore the various categories of health plans available, such as PPOs, and choose the structure that best accommodates your needs.
